With Assassin's Creed Shadows imminent, Ubisoft has lifted the veil on The Animus Hub, the project once known as Assassin's Creed Infinity, which it definitely doesn't want you to say is a new Assassin's Creed launcher.

In a presentation ahead of today's big Assassin's Creed Shadows preview, Andrée-Anne Boisvert, a long-standing producer on the Assassin's Creed series, introduced The Animus Hub by saying "we're building a new home for Assassin's Creed moving forward, a place that will allow us to see our beloved franchise through an entirely new lens."
